How to add phosphates to dishwasher detergent?
You can buy Trisodium phosphate from any super shop or online store.
You can directly mix a 1/2 or 1/4 teaspoon phosphate with the dishwasher detergent into the dispenser compartment per load. The phosphate is very affordable but can improve dishwasher performance 3 xs than before.

Why is phosphate a popular cleaning agent?
Phosphate helps to loosen the toughest food residue from dishes, balance water hardness, and discard water soil in the dishwasher that making it a popular agent.
